> > So as a first formal step since we instituted the new 3rd party software policy 
> > I am proposing Chrome. We been communicating with Google for a little bit and things
> > are looking good in terms of getting the things we need included in the Chrome repository. 
> > Once we have gotten this appstream patch merged (https://codereview.chromium.org/2424093003)
> > we should have all the pieces needed to include Chrome as a third party application in 
> > GNOME Software. So I want to propose that we add discussing this to the next workstation
> > meeting agenda.
> 
> Awesome this has gotten so far! Great work Christian and tpopela and
> hughsie and everybody else involved in this!

Agreed.  We know from other fairly random sampling that about half of
Fedora users install Chrome for a web browser.  Making it a bit easier
for them to get it sounds like a benefit to me.  I'll make sure this
is on our next agenda.  I suppose the point is just to make sure that
we have all actions taken care of to include.  Would this be an update
later to the fedora-workstation-repos package?
